首页 > 文章列表
  • MySQL中ibd文件的作用和特点详解
    MySQL中ibd文件的作用和特点详解
    MySQL中ibd文件的作用和特点详解在MySQL数据库中,每个InnoDB表都对应一个.ibd文件,这个文件是InnoDB存储引擎用来存储表的数据和索引的地方。ibd文件是InnoDB表空间的一部分,它和.ibdata文件一起组成了InnoDB的表空间。作用:存储表的数据和索引:ibd文件是存储I
    mysql 特点 ibd文件
    488 2024-03-15
  • MySQL连接数配置的技巧和注意事项
    MySQL连接数配置的技巧和注意事项
    MySQL连接数设置技巧与注意事项MySQL是一种常用的关系型数据库管理系统,在实际应用中,对于MySQL连接数的设置要特别注意,以确保系统的稳定性和性能。本文将介绍关于MySQL连接数设置的技巧和注意事项,并提供具体的代码示例供参考。1. 连接数的概念在MySQL中,连接数指的是同时连接到数据库的
    注意事项 MySQL技巧 连接数设置
    384 2024-03-15
  • MySQL.proc表的结构和功能详解
    MySQL.proc表的结构和功能详解
    MySQL.proc表是MySQL数据库中存储存储过程和函数信息的系统表,通过深入了解其结构及用途,可以更好地理解存储过程和函数在MySQL中的运行机制,并进行相关的管理和优化。下面将详细解析MySQL.proc表的结构及用途,并提供具体的代码示例。1. MySQL.proc表的结构MySQL.pr
    mysql proc 结构
    210 2024-03-15
  • 在MySQL数据库中外键的使用及其价值
    在MySQL数据库中外键的使用及其价值
    外键在MySQL数据库中的重要性和实践意义在MySQL数据库中,外键(Foreign Key)是一种用来建立不同表之间关联关系的重要约束。外键约束确保了表与表之间的数据一致性和完整性,能够有效避免不正确的数据插入、更新或删除操作。一、外键的重要性:数据完整性:外键约束可以确保在一个表中的数据引用另一
    mysql 数据 外键
    224 2024-03-15
  • 深入探讨MySQL视图的定义和应用
    深入探讨MySQL视图的定义和应用
    MySQL视图的定义与用途详解什么是MySQL视图?MySQL视图是一种虚拟的表,它是根据SQL查询语句得到的结果集按照某种规则组织在一起的数据表。它提供了一个可被查询的结构化视图,方便用户根据自己的需求来获取数据。MySQL视图的定义在MySQL中,定义一个视图的语法如下:CREATE VIEW
    mysql 用途 视图
    337 2024-03-15
  • 使用MySQL触发器实现数据库操作的自动化
    使用MySQL触发器实现数据库操作的自动化
    标题:利用MySQL触发器实现数据库操作自动化在数据库管理中,触发器是一种强大的工具,能够帮助我们实现数据库操作的自动化。MySQL作为一款广泛应用的开源数据库管理系统,也提供了触发器功能,我们可以利用MySQL触发器来实现数据库操作的自动化。本文将介绍MySQL触发器的基本概念和具体实现方法,同时
    自动化 数据库操作 MySQL触发器
    391 2024-03-15
  • MySQL中数据变更操作是否立即生效?
    MySQL中数据变更操作是否立即生效?
    MySQL中数据修改操作默认情况下是自动提交的,即每次执行UPDATE、INSERT、DELETE等修改数据的操作后,都会立即生效并提交到数据库中。这样做的好处是确保数据的一致性和持久性,但有时也会带来一定的风险,比如在执行多个修改操作时,可能希望一次性提交所有操作,而不是每个操作都立即提交。MyS
    mysql 数据修改 自动提交
    203 2024-03-15
  • MySQL的各个版本是什么?
    MySQL的各个版本是什么?
    MySQL是一种流行的开源关系型数据库管理系统,拥有多个版本,每个版本都有自己的特点和功能。在本文中,我们将介绍一些常见的MySQL版本,并附上相应的代码示例。MySQL Community Edition:MySQL Community Edition 是MySQL官方发布的免费版本,适用于个人用
    mysql 版本 关键词
    378 2024-03-15
  • 会在MySQL中UPDATE操作触发表级锁吗?
    会在MySQL中UPDATE操作触发表级锁吗?
    MySQL的UPDATE操作是否会造成表级锁定?在MySQL数据库中,当执行UPDATE操作时,是否会造成表级锁定,这是一个常见而又重要的问题。表级锁定会影响数据库的并发性能,因此了解UPDATE操作是否会引起表级锁定对于优化数据库的性能至关重要。MySQL的锁定机制分为表级锁定和行级锁定两种。表级
    表级锁定检查
    187 2024-03-15
  • MySQL是否具备类似于PL/SQL的功能?
    MySQL是否具备类似于PL/SQL的功能?
    MySQL是否支持类似PL/SQL的功能,需要具体代码示例MySQL是一种常见的关系型数据库管理系统,被广泛应用于各种类型的应用程序开发中。与Oracle的PL/SQL相比,MySQL并不原生支持类似的存储过程和触发器等功能。尽管MySQL内置了存储过程、触发器和函数等,则其语法和用法与PL/SQL
    300 2024-03-15
  • 限制和定义MySQL数据库中的外键
    限制和定义MySQL数据库中的外键
    标题:MySQL数据库中外键的定义和限制在MySQL数据库中,外键是一种用于建立表与表之间关系的约束。外键可以确保在一个表中的数据与另一个表中的数据具有一定的关联性。通过定义外键,我们可以实现数据之间的参照完整性,从而保证数据的一致性和可靠性。1. 外键的定义在MySQL中,外键可以通过以下语法来定
    外键定义 外键限制 MySQL外键
    119 2024-03-15
  • 深入探讨MySQL中的存储过程和PL/SQL之间的联系
    深入探讨MySQL中的存储过程和PL/SQL之间的联系
    标题:探究MySQL中的存储过程与PL/SQL的关系在数据库开发中,存储过程是一种预先编译的SQL语句集合,可以在数据库服务器上执行。MySQL是一种流行的关系型数据库管理系统,它支持存储过程的使用。而PL/SQL是Oracle数据库特有的过程化编程语言,类似于存储过程,但具有更丰富的功能和语法。M
    mysql 存储过程 PL/SQL
    147 2024-03-15
  • 在MySQL中如何使用唯一索引保证数据的唯一性
    在MySQL中如何使用唯一索引保证数据的唯一性
    标题:MySQL中创建唯一索引来确保数据唯一性的方法及代码示例在数据库设计中,确保数据的唯一性是非常重要的,可以通过在MySQL中创建唯一索引来实现。唯一索引可以保证表中某列(或列组合)的数值是唯一的,如果尝试插入重复值,MySQL会阻止这种操作并报错。本文将介绍如何在MySQL中创建唯一索引,同时
    数据唯一性 MySQL索引 唯一索引
    420 2024-03-15
  • 深入探讨MySQL触发器参数的设置
    深入探讨MySQL触发器参数的设置
    MySQL 触发器是一种在数据库表中定义的一系列操作,当满足特定条件时自动触发执行。触发器可以在 insert、update 或 delete 操作前或后执行一些特定的SQL语句,以实现数据变化时的自动化处理。触发器的参数设置对于正确的使用和效率优化非常重要,本文将深入探讨MySQL触发器的参数设置
    mysql 参数 触发器
    344 2024-03-15
  • 自动关联MySQL外键和主键的方法
    自动关联MySQL外键和主键的方法
    如何让MySQL外键和主键自动关联起来?在MySQL数据库中,外键和主键是非常重要的概念,它们能够帮助我们在不同表之间建立关联关系,保证数据的完整性和一致性。在实际的应用过程中,经常需要让外键自动关联到对应的主键上,以避免数据不一致的情况发生。下面将介绍如何通过具体的代码示例实现这一功能。首先,我们
    主键 外键 关联
    207 2024-03-15
  • 深入探讨MySQL时间戳的含义和使用
    深入探讨MySQL时间戳的含义和使用
    MySQL时间戳是一种用来表示日期和时间的数据类型,通常以整数形式存储。时间戳在数据库中被广泛应用,可以记录数据的创建时间、修改时间等信息,并且可以实现时间相关的操作和查询。在MySQL中,时间戳有两种常见的形式,分别是UNIX时间戳和DATETIME类型的时间戳。UNIX时间戳UNIX时间戳是指从
    mysql 时间戳 解析
    164 2024-03-15
  • MySQL中外键和主键之间的自动连接机制是什么?
    MySQL中外键和主键之间的自动连接机制是什么?
    MySQL中外键和主键的自动连接机制是通过建立外键约束来实现的。外键约束是一种关系约束,在一个表中的字段与另一个表中的字段建立关联,从而确保数据的一致性和完整性。主键是一个表中唯一标识每一行数据的字段,而外键则是另一个表中的主键,用于建立表与表之间的关联。在MySQL中,当我们在一个表中定义一个外键
    174 2024-03-15
  • 正确处理MySQL中的布尔类型数据
    正确处理MySQL中的布尔类型数据
    如何在MySQL中正确处理布尔类型数据MySQL是一种常用的关系型数据库管理系统,其中布尔类型数据在数据库中被表示为TINYINT类型,通常用0表示False,1表示True。在处理布尔类型数据时,正确的使用方法能够提高数据的准确性和可读性,本文将介绍在MySQL中正确处理布尔类型数据的方法,并提供
    397 2024-03-15
  • 详细介绍MySQL中布尔数据类型的用法
    详细介绍MySQL中布尔数据类型的用法
    MySQL中布尔类型的使用方法详解MySQL是一种常用的关系型数据库管理系统,在实际应用中经常需要使用布尔类型来表示逻辑上的真假值。MySQL中布尔类型有两种表示方式:TINYINT(1)和BOOL。本文将详细介绍MySQL中布尔类型的使用方法,包括布尔类型的定义、赋值、查询和修改等操作,同时结合具
    mysql 数据类型 布尔值
    240 2024-03-15
  • 详解数据库设计中的 MySQL 复合主键
    详解数据库设计中的 MySQL 复合主键
    MySQL 复合主键在数据库设计中的应用详解MySQL 复合主键是指由多个字段组成的主键,通过组合这些字段的值来唯一标识一条记录。在数据库设计中,复合主键的应用非常广泛,特别是在需要唯一标识某个实体的情况下。本文将详细介绍MySQL复合主键的概念、设计原则以及具体的代码示例。一、MySQL复合主键的
    mysql 数据库设计 复合主键
    111 2024-03-15